Why Trellis Design Matters for Summer Blooms
Trellises and arch structures do more than add garden aesthetics—they create vertical growth opportunities, improve air circulation, and boost sunlight exposure for healthy plant development. Whether you grow wisteria, sweet peas, climbers, or climbing roses, a well-designed trellis ensures stronger growth and heavier blooms.
1. Choose the Right Materials for Summer Performance

The durability of your arch trellis directly impacts summer success. Opt for weather-resistant materials such as:
- Treated hardwood or cedar: Resistant to rot and insects
- Aluminum or galvanized steel: Strong and corrosion-proof, perfect for heavy blooms
- Composite materials: Low maintenance and long-lasting
Never use untreated wood—it decays quickly under summer sun and moisture.
2. Optimal Placement for Sun & Airflow

Maximize your trellis’s heat and wind resistance by placing it:
- Facing east or southeast to catch morning sun but avoid harsh afternoon heat
- With spacing around plants to allow airflow, reducing fungal diseases
- In a stable foundation—use concrete footings or deep planters to prevent tipping in summer winds
Consider how sun exposure moves through your garden and position trellises accordingly for spring through fall blooms.
3. Smart Arch Design Tips for Climbing Success
To support vibrant summer foliage and flowers:
- Arches with a gentle curve encourage natural plant progression
- Wider lattice panels (2x2 inches or more) provide enough grip for vigorous climbers
- Install cross-supports or horizontal braces between arches for additional stability
Try pairing contrasting plantings—hardy vines on one side, delicate flowers on the other—to create dynamic summer focal points.
